Hershey (NYSE:HSY - Get Free Report) had its target price hoisted by investment analysts at Barclays from $165.00 to $190.00 in a research report issued to clients and investors on Friday,Benzinga reports. The brokerage currently has an "equal weight" rating on the stock. Barclays's price target suggests a potential upside of 0.84% from the stock's current price.

Hershey (NYSE:HSY -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Wednesday, July 30th. The company reported $1.21 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$0.98 by $0.23. Hershey had a net margin of 13.54% and a return on equity of 37.36%. The business had revenue of $2.61 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$2.50 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$1.27 earnings per share. The firm's revenue for the quarter was up 26.0% on a year-over-year basis. Analysts anticipate that Hershey will post 6.12 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

The Hershey Company,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the manufacture and sale of confectionery products and pantry items in the United States and internationally. The company operates through three segments: North America Confectionery, North America Salty Snacks, and International. It offers chocolate and non-chocolate confectionery products; gum and mint refreshment products, including mints, chewing gums, and bubble gums; protein bars; pantry items, such as baking ingredients, toppings, beverages, and sundae syrups; and snack items comprising spreads, bars, snack bites, mixes, popcorn, and pretzels.
